Skip to content

Commit

Permalink
Merge remote-tracking branch 'upstream/3.0.x' into merge_3.0.x
Browse files Browse the repository at this point in the history
  • Loading branch information
Morgan Haskel committed Nov 12, 2014
2 parents ad709af + 810ceb1 commit b06d3fe
Show file tree
Hide file tree
Showing 3 changed files with 32 additions and 8 deletions.
24 changes: 24 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
@@ -1,3 +1,27 @@
##2014-11-11 - Supported Release 3.0.0
###Summary

Added several new features including MariaDB support and future parser

####Backwards-incompatible Changes
* Remove the deprecated `database`, `database_user`, and `database_grant` resources. The correct resources to use are `mysql`, `mysql_user`, and `mysql_grant` respectively.

####Features
* Add MariaDB Support
* The mysqltuner perl script has been updated to 1.3.0 based on work at http://github.com/major/MySQLTuner-perl
* Add future parse support, fixed issues with undef to empty string
* Pass the backup credentials to 'SHOW DATABASES'
* Ability to specify the Includedir for `mysql::server`
* `mysql::db` now has an import\_timeout feature that defaults to 300
* The `mysql` class has been removed
* `mysql::server` now takes an `override_options` hash that will affect the installation
* Ability to install both dev and client dev

####BugFix
* `mysql::server::backup` now passes `ensure` param to the nested `mysql_grant`
* `mysql::server::service` now properly requires the presence of the `log_error` file
* `mysql::config` now occurs before `mysql::server::install_db` correctly

##2014-07-15 - Supported Release 2.3.1
###Summary

Expand Down
9 changes: 6 additions & 3 deletions Gemfile
Original file line number Diff line number Diff line change
@@ -1,15 +1,18 @@
source ENV['GEM_SOURCE'] || "https://rubygems.org"

group :development, :test do
group :development, :unit_tests do
gem 'rake', :require => false
gem 'rspec-puppet', :require => false
gem 'puppetlabs_spec_helper', :require => false
gem 'serverspec', :require => false
gem 'puppet-lint', :require => false
gem 'beaker-rspec', :require => false
gem 'puppet_facts', :require => false
end

group :system_tests do
gem 'beaker-rspec', :require => false
gem 'serverspec', :require => false
end

if facterversion = ENV['FACTER_GEM_VERSION']
gem 'facter', facterversion, :require => false
else
Expand Down
7 changes: 2 additions & 5 deletions metadata.json
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@
"license": "Apache 2.0",
"source": "git://github.com/puppetlabs/puppetlabs-mysql.git",
"project_page": "http://github.com/puppetlabs/puppetlabs-mysql",
"issues_url": "https://github.com/puppetlabs/puppetlabs-mysql/issues",
"issues_url": "https://tickets.puppetlabs.com/browse/MODULES",
"operatingsystem_support": [
{
"operatingsystem": "RedHat",
Expand Down Expand Up @@ -75,9 +75,6 @@
],
"description": "Mysql module",
"dependencies": [
{
"name": "puppetlabs/stdlib",
"version_requirement": ">= 3.2.0"
}
{"name":"puppetlabs/stdlib","version_requirement":">= 3.2.0"}
]
}

0 comments on commit b06d3fe

Please sign in to comment.